Understanding Seal Strength Testing

Seal strength testers play a critical role in the quality assurance process for various products, particularly in packaging, food, and pharmaceuticals. The effectiveness of a seal can significantly influence the product's shelf life, safety, and overall quality.

Step 1: Identifying the Importance of Seal Integrity

The first step is recognizing that seal integrity is essential for preventing contamination and maintaining product freshness. Poor seals can lead to product spoilage, which can be costly for manufacturers and detrimental to consumers.

Step 2: Choosing the Right Seal Strength Tester

Selecting an appropriate seal strength tester involves considering factors such as the type of material to be tested and the specific requirements of the product. Various testers are available, ranging from handheld units for quick checks to advanced laboratory equipment for detailed analysis.

Step 3: Conducting Seal Strength Tests

Once the right tester is chosen, the next step is to perform the seal strength tests. This involves:

  1. Preparing samples by sealing them according to standard methods.
  2. Setting up the testing equipment correctly to ensure accurate results.
  3. Running tests to measure the force needed to break the seal, documenting the data collected.

Step 4: Analyzing Test Results

After the tests have been conducted, the next step is to analyze the results. This analysis helps identify any weaknesses in the seal strength and can influence adjustments in the sealing process or materials used.

Step 5: Implementing Quality Control Measures

Following the analysis, it is crucial to implement quality control measures based on the findings. This may include adjustments to the production process, retraining personnel on sealing techniques, or changing suppliers for sealing materials to ensure optimal performance.

Step 6: Regular Calibration and Maintenance

To maintain high standards of quality assurance, regular calibration and maintenance of seal strength testers are necessary. This ensures that the equipment continues to provide accurate measurements and that any new issues are addressed promptly.
